Combat history in brief

The P-47D Thunderbolt served extensively with the U.S. Army Air Force, earning a reputation for toughness and significant firepower thanks to eight .50 caliber guns. Its ability to carry bombs and rockets made it an effective escort and ground attack platform.

Specifications

  • Scale: 1/72
  • Material: PS plastic
  • Assembly: Glue required
  • Paint: Not included
Build time varies with skill and finishing level, but a straightforward assembly and basic paint job can take several evenings; advanced detailing will add more time.
The kit is detailed for its scale, but optional photoetched sets can enhance cockpit and exterior fine details if you want extra realism.
Careful panel line washing, subtle weathering and correct decal placement will make the small-scale Thunderbolt look more authentic on display.
